Transaction 5c87621393da5baf0cf1e5af7b186c2d8d229e486cb70f146ed0f9efa4c4024c

2 Input
2 Outputs
  • 5c87621393da5baf0cf1e5af7b186c2d8d229e486cb70f146ed0f9efa4c4024c:0
  • value  9594450
    address  17Rin7S4n2Y4WurQUD2wrDqJNMPwokpBLE
  • 5c87621393da5baf0cf1e5af7b186c2d8d229e486cb70f146ed0f9efa4c4024c:1
  • value  3382169
    address  bc1q29gnu6g78hnkz26va3u6j7tnyvhspg2qywljup